National Occupational Exposure Survey
(1981 - 1983)

Estimated Numbers of Employees Potentially Exposed to Specific Agents by 2-Digit Standard Industrial Classification (SIC)*

Agent Name NEPHELINE SYENITE
CAS # 37244-96-5
RTECS #
Agent Code X3069

SIC Industry Description (1972) Total # Employees
(Male & Female)
Total # Female
Employees
07 AGRICULTURAL SERVICES 403  
17 SPECIAL TRADE CONTRACTORS 8,642  
20 FOOD AND KINDRED PRODUCTS 1,429  
23 APPAREL AND OTHER TEXTILE PRODUCTS 572  
24 LUMBER AND WOOD PRODUCTS 952  
26 PAPER AND ALLIED PRODUCTS 703  
28 CHEMICALS AND ALLIED PRODUCTS 1,712 43
32 STONE, CLAY, AND GLASS PRODUCTS 5,733 1,829
33 PRIMARY METAL INDUSTRIES 136  
34 FABRICATED METAL PRODUCTS 1,009 336
35 MACHINERY, EXCEPT ELECTRICAL 7,489 132
36 ELECTRIC AND ELECTRONIC EQUIPMENT 769  
37 TRANSPORTATION EQUIPMENT 6,187 1,202
38 INSTRUMENTS AND RELATED PRODUCTS 502  
39 MISCELLANEOUS MANUFACTURING INDUSTRIES 1,969 454
42 TRUCKING AND WAREHOUSING 1,121  
50 WHOLESALE TRADE - DURABLE GOODS 176  
75 AUTO REPAIR, SERVICES, AND GARAGES 5,597  
80 HEALTH SERVICES 153  
TOTAL 45,255 3,996

*(1) By survey design, not all 2-digit SICs were surveyed. (2) The estimates for each 2-digit SIC apply only to the 3- and 4-digit SICs surveyed within the 2-digit SIC. Not all SICs were surveyed. (3) When using the estimates, standard errors associated with estimates should be considered. (4) Potential exposures to a chemical agent are categorized as actual (i.e., the surveyor observed the use of the specific agent) or tradename (i.e., the surveyor observed the use of a tradename product known to contain the specific agent). The estimates presented in the table combine both categories.
